Someone might also like to know that expressions are persistant in /gposemode as well, so if you choose "closed eyes" for example your character will keep them closed until you come back out of /gpose.

I just wish I could do emotes during /gpose.
you can. Just do the emote command first, followed by the facial expression emote, then finally /gpose. You will simultaneously do the emote and the expression in /gpose mode and the animations will repeat until you exit gpose.
